FARGO (KFGO/KVRR) – The Fargo Public Schools’ Director of Equity and Inclusion is stepping down and the name of the job title is being revised.
Dr. Tamara Uselman was the school district’s first equity and inclusion director. She’s held the title since July, 2020.
Communications Officer AnnMarie Campbell says Uselman submitted her resignation on March 8 and will continue to be employed by Fargo Public Schools.
“Dr. Uselman has recently submitted her resignation/retirement paperwork, which is effective June 30, 2023. We are happy to report she will still be working with us on a part-time basis doing administrator mentor work.”
The district has decided to rename the department from Equity and Inclusion Department to the Educational Justice Department.
“The term Educational Justice more clearly describes the work of Fargo Public Schools and our current Equity and Inclusion Department,” Campbell said.
The salary for the newly-created position ranges from $104,671 to $128,844.
